The capacities may be more popular than ever, but street trucks are still absent from the modern squad. Auto industry companies have become longer, not shorter, but a new package of Roush helps fill this gap by giving FORD F-150 to properly low.
The group drops three inches in the front and five inches in the back. The developed suspension includes performance files, drops of drops, a twin tube discounts, progressive springs, and the upgraded SWAY tape. Roche claims that the Pick August achieved 0.79gs on a 200 -foot circular slide pad on the track with XLT Supercrew in its test.

The package also enhances the appearance of the truck by adding a front grille with an integrated amber lamps, hood hoods, and graphics package. Black black wheels fill twenty-two inches at 305/40R22 General Tyre G-Max AS07 All Abeason Rubber wheel wells, which hide the preserved brake circuits to improve stopping power.
Inside, Ford gets a dedicated Raven’s black skin with red accents of anger, serial badges, and aluminum pedals. Roush has three options exclusively for XLT TRIM: the sound upgrade in the Alps, the interior carbon fiber trim, and the safe central control unit.

Roush Nitemare starts from $ 19,999 and does not include the main car. The limited packet for CAB F-150 XL and XLT are available. The F-150 XL starts with a regular taxi from $ 39,445 (prices include $ 1,995 destination fee) for 2025. F-150 XLT Supercrew has a starting price of $ 50,050.
This means that the minimum you will pay for Nitemare is $ 59,444. Certainly, he will not be able to Raptor. But it is much cheaper, and in our opinion, it is more interesting.
